TLDR : Answer Summary
Returning to Thailand after a brief trip abroad on a tourist visa or visa exemption can present challenges, particularly if you've maxed out your last visa. Immigration control might ask for proof of funds (20,000 THB or equivalent), accommodation details, and onward travel. This scrutiny is more common for individuals who have a pattern of consecutive tourist visas or visa exemptions.
Immigration can ask for 3 proofs on arrival: 20.000 Thb cash or equivalent currency, accommodation and onward travel. There are normally only asked to people with a history of back to back tourist visa's and Visa Exempt Entries.
